Jayam Ravi’s Transformation

One of the most discussed elements of this film is Jayam Ravi’s choice to change his name to Ravi Mohan. This daring decision has attracted considerable attention and prompted curiosity about the reasons behind it. What’s even more fascinating is how this change mirrors his evolution as an actor. After encountering hurdles in both his personal life and career, "Kadhalikka Neramillai" represents a crucial project for him, and Balu suggests that this could signal a significant comeback.

In the film, Ravi’s character traverses a rich emotional terrain that resonates with the audience. His performance is nuanced, revealing both vulnerability and strength, and it’s evident that he is dedicated to making this role unforgettable. As fans have come to expect from Ravi, he infuses a sense of authenticity into his character that keeps viewers captivated.

Characters and Storyline

Directed by Krithika Udhayanidhi, "Kadhalikka Neramillai" tells a love story filled with misunderstandings, humor, and emotional depth. The film explores the characters' lives, revealing how love influences their choices and relationships. Balu emphasizes the impressive character development, particularly commending Nithya Menen for her remarkable ability to fully embody her role.

Nithya Menen, celebrated for her versatile acting, delivers a standout performance. Balu refers to her as an "acting powerhouse," capable of seamlessly transforming into any character she takes on. This talent elevates the film, turning it into more than just a love story; it becomes a profound exploration of personal identities and connections. The chemistry between Jayam Ravi and Nithya Menen is evident, making their interactions on screen a delight to experience.

Music and Technical Aspects

A standout feature of "Kadhalikka Neramillai" is its music, created by the legendary A. R. Rahman. Balu highlights how Rahman’s compositions elevate the film, providing a sonic backdrop that enhances the emotional depth of the story. The music acts as a narrative tool, capturing the essence of the characters’ journeys and emphasizing key moments.
